This is the best holiday destination we have ever been on! Cancun is such a gorgeous place! Like many others we checked the hotel on this site before booking &I was quite worried, but had a great time!

Disadvantages
The moody man on reception, who didn’t give us a very warm welcome, but it was ok coz all the other staff are lovely, especially the restaurant staff!

The room was quite small & we found out from others that you have to moan a lot to move& we could not be bothered coz I wanted to unpack & settle.

No entertainment during the day, other than volleyball&footie, where as in the other hotels it was quite lively, but it was nice 2 have some peace &quiet

Sea was not great compared to other spots, but it did the job of cooling you down& the hotel was still in a beautiful location.

Bar closed too early! At 11

Advantages
Due to the hotel being small we made loads of new friends (Thanks to Jules&Graham, who made our hol so fun!)

Hotel lovely and clean, fresh sheets& towels daily.

The staff were soooooooo friendly and sweet& remembered your drinks.

The entertainment on the night was organised daily& it was all V.I.P where you went down in a coach with everyone from the hotel, got your own spot in the club aswell& sometimes tables, where you would have your own waiter for the night.

Amazing Restaurant. The only one in the sea out of all the hotels, I don’t know how anyone could fault it, it was so pretty, looking out to the sea. The food was good, a lot of people moaned about the variety, but we thought there was plenty! Breakfast is great, with a chef making fresh omelettes & you got snacks in between.

Massive shower, plenty of room. Tip = for hot water turn the small tap on at the bottom&keep it on!

The hotel is the last hotel on the trip, but it is only 10 mins away from the town & you can get a bus for 30p & they are extremely regular (not like our buses)

A variety of people stop her & they are really down to earth, we meet, English, Irish, Mexicans, Americans etc.

Its very cheap to stop here & worth the money! I would recommend it for younger people or those young at heart who enjoy fun& meeting new people. If your not into clubbing then the bar is not much good for you, as you will have to have an early night. A lot of people moaned when we were there, but we just though what are you moaning at, your in Mexico for god sake!
THE DOLPHIN DISCOVERY IS AMAZING, ASK REP. i WOULD DO IT A T THE OTHER ISLAND, IS ALOT NATURAL& NICER FOR THE DOLPHINS BECAUSE THEY ARE IN THE SEA. excaret is a good excursion also, lots of animals&good shows!

Five of us guys wanted a cheap all inclusive holiday to Mexico so we booked the trip independently without going through a major tour operator. Tne actual cost per person for the holiday (less the flights) was £117 per person which included the room, all the food and drink for the week and I think this just emphasises how good value the hotel was for the money spent. Ignore the independent reviews as the major tour operators were charging in excess of £1000 per week for the same bank holiday week. Yes the facilities are basic but where else could you get 'board and lodgings' and unlimited food and drink for under £120 per week - certainly not in England !! The rooms were cleaned everyday, the towels were changed everyday and we couldnt fault any of the day to day staff in the hotel at all. We found them always to be helpful whatever shift they were on, night or day.

Although the food was not 5* you could find something nice to eat every meal time and the staff would bend over backwards to help you. Kevin and Amhir the hotel animation guys were fantastic and they really looked after us on ours nights out. Some guests were saying £22 /$40 for a night out in Cancun central at one of the top clubs was expensive - bear in mind this included a 15 min cab ride, VIP entry in to the Club, a 'waitered' table and as much vodka, beer etc as you could drink. Much recommended nights out ! WARNING !! Do not play Kevin at football - 5 of us could only manage a draw aginst the one of him !!!.

All in all we had a totally fantastic drunken week !!

Will definately be going back again later in the year !!

stayed there for 2 weeks and the hotel was fine. It is dated in comparison to most other hotels but its very clean with the sheets and towels being changed every day.

staff are very friendly like all the mexican amigos.

food was nice but would have liked more variety. you get mexican, italian, caribbean and then international repeated over. ended up eating out for a change.

breakfast and lunches are fine, something for everyone.

my only gripe is that the bar shuts at 11. would have liked it to stay open until at least 12, poss 1am.

wouldnt recommend it if you have kids. nothing really for them to do during the day.

the hotel is the first in the zone so its quiet. you will need to get a bus to the busier areas which only costs 30p each way. they are every 5 mins at the most. never get a taxi as they will be looking for at least a £5 upwards.

dont book your excursions through the reps. they will try and put the fear into you and say you will be ripped off by the vendors on the street. i used them for 5 different excursions and had no problems at all plus they were alot cheaper. other people in the hotel did the same again with other vendors and also had no problems. there are vendors all along the hotel zone so you will have no trouble finding them. we used demo tours at playa tourgas. look out for it on the bus. opposite aquaworld.

you get what you pay for at the end of the day and i did find it good value. some people expect 5 star without paying the premium for it..

After reading some pretty rubbish reviews we thought the place would be a dump but it was lovely! Fairly basic but thats what you pay for. Food was fine although eating the same for two weeks was pretty boring but didn't expect it to be any different.

Room was really big and air con. worked. Due to hotel being small you get to know the other guests which is good and all staff were really friendly which gave the hotel a great fun atmosphere. Don't book nights out through your rep - go with the hotel crowd and book through Kevin who is there everyday by the pool.

Beach was cleaned every morning and although the sea wasn't the nicest you can nip over to the other island (15min boat trip - $7 return) where the sea is gorgeous!

Overall had a brilliant holiday and would recommend the hotel for people who are up for a laugh rather than families.

Very disappointed with hotel, food which was repetitive and served in a shack on the water which we nicknamed Tenko hut. The location was farthest away from town centre but buses ran every 5 minutes.Most staff friendly for 1st week particularly El Sabio barman, but quite rude and hostile 2nd week. Got change of room 2nd day as it was very noisy with banging doors and traffic. Myself and other guests were constantly complaining of rooms, lack of activities, sunbeds and tables and chairs at bar area. Maybe ok for 18-30s but not for families or couples looking for a bit of relaxation. Concierge quite grumpy and not very helpful, possibly due to all the complaints he was receiving. Met a lot of nice people whilst at hotel, but if we visit Cancun again it certainly won`t be the Imperial Las Perlas. Will check gazetteer next time of booking and will gladly pay that bit extra for the many nicer hotels in Cancun.
